| Sigismondo
Malatesta 
In
the middle period between Middle ages and Renaissance
the Signoria dei Malatesta has been one of the most
important families in Italy ruling for more than
300 years all over Romagna and. Their most important
town was Rimini.In a blend of fights, battles and
passions, the Malatesta influenced the land of Rimini
all over building in all the territory great artistic
masterpieces and symbols of power such as their
extraordinary Rocks and Fortresses.
Sigismondo
Pandolfo Malatesta has ever been considered has
the Symbol all the Malatesta, The real Lord in Rimini,
the one that brought to their maximum extension
his family.
He
was a leader and a prince, he became famous for
his courage and strength blended with obstinacy.
A man of great culture, he used to be rounded from
artists and literate
His
existence was characterised by great victories and
conquests but also from contrast with Papas and
fights with his last and strength enemy and neighbour:
Federico II da Montefeltro, Duca di Urbino.
After
his death (1468) and the end of the Malatesta domain,
the land of were full of traces he left all over
and they are still a living and passionate part
of the territory, from the sea and sweet hills.
